linux切换权限命令linux切换权限

作者&投稿:征残 (若有异议请与网页底部的电邮联系)
~

linux修改命令?

chmod

u+s

ifconfig

给命令添加一个setuid权限就可以,这样执行命令时,普通用户就成了root。

在linux中,不管是root用户还是普通用户,都可以使用“password”命令来更改自身的密码。但是,linux中的密码通常是保存在“/etc/paswd”和“/etc/shadow”文件中,这两个文件对系统安全至关重要,因此只有root用户才能对其执行读写操作。以管理员的身份登陆系统,在linxu提示符下执行“ls

/etc/passwd

/etc/shadow”命令,在返回信息中可以看到普通用户对上述这两个文件并没有写权限,因此从文件属性的角度看,普通用户在更改自身密码时,是无法将密码信息写入到上述文件中的,哪么用户是怎样成功的更改密码的呢?实际上,问题的关键不在于密码文件本身,而在于密码更改命令“passwd”。在提示符下执行命令“ls

/usr/bin/passwd”,在返回信息中的文件所有者执行权限位上显示“s”字样,表示“passwd”命令具有setuid权限,其所有者为root,这样普通用户在执行“passwd”命令时,实际上以有效用户root的身份来执行的,并具有了相应的权限,从而将新的密码写入到“/etc/passwd”和“/etc/shadow”文件中,当命令执行完毕,该用户的身份立即消失。如何设置setuid权限呢?使用“chmod”命令即可为指定文件设置setuid权限,例如“chmod

4xxx

filename”命令,取消setuid权限的命令为“chmod

xxx

filename”。类似的,执行“chmod

2xxx

filename”命令可以设置setuid权限,使用“chmod

xxx

filename”命令即可取消setgid权限,如果执行“chmod

6xxx

filename”命令,即可同时为指定文件设置setuid和setgid,执行命令“chmod

0xxx

filename”,即可同时取消指定文件的setuid和setgid权限。例如以root用户登陆系统,执行“chmod

0511

/usr/bin/passwd”命令,就可以取消“passwd”命令的setuid权限,这样普通用户就无法修改自己的密码了。

linux什么命令修改文件权限?

Linux修改文件和文件夹的权限用chmod命令,chmod命令格式为:

chmodxyz要修改权限的文件或目录

其中x是文件或目录的所有者的rwx权限相加,y是文件或目录的所属用户组的rwx权限相加,z是其他用户对文件或目录的rwx权限相加。而rwx分别的权重是4、2、1,比如:

chmod755/root/testfile的设置含义是:设置/root/testfile的权限字符串为-rwxr-xr-x(分别对应x=r+w+x=4+2+1=7,y=r+w+x=4+0+1=5,z=r+w+x=4+0+1=5)。

chmod命令还有一个重要参数需要了解:-R参数(大写的R),这个参数表示进行权限的递归设置,就是将文件夹及此文件夹下的所有文件和子目录都进行权限的更改。示例:

chmod755-R/root/testdir/

linux下,如何修改一个文件的权限(命令)?

用acl,accesscontrollist。

不过印象里需要修改磁盘的挂载参数,打开acl支持。

设置acl用命令setfacl,获取权限用getfacl。

注意必须内核里面打开了你的硬盘分区类型驱动的acl支持才能启动分区到acl功能。如果你的系统是流行的大型发行版,而且没有自己编译内核。那么应该是默认支持了,修改挂载参数后就可以用了。

注意啊!分区类型的驱动要支持acl才可以!fatntfs驱动都不支持acl而且没有补丁没有插件。建议使用ext3/4、reiserfs来支持acl。

(可能ntfs-3g支持,但我没见到过相关的信息。)。

在linux系统中,修改文件权限的具体命令是啥?

chmodu,g,o+/-/=r,w,xobjectu(user),g(group),o(other)+表示增加-表示减少=表示赋予相应值u+r表示拥有者增加一个r(读)权限,g+w表示拥有组增加一个w(写)权限,o+x表示其它用户增加一个执行权限权限也可以使用数字法rwxrwxrwxugo421421421每个权限位加起来就是7,比如:chmod777a就是将a这个文件修改为rwxrwxrwx,chmod644a就是将a的权限修改为rw-r--r--。

linux修改密码显示权限不够?

这个就是你的系统设置借权限




在linux下自己创建了一个用户,使用su切换到该用户后,用ls命令的时候提示...
usermod -G 修改所属组,加到root组中去

我在Linux下 用java调用一个软件的安装,但是这个软件是需要root权限,我...
目前在Android手机上,还没有统一的获取 ROOT的方法,各个机型在获取ROOT权限 时的操作要点也不尽相同。目前主流的一键 ROOT软件有 Z4ROOT,UniversalAndroot,visionaryplus,GingerBreak 等,到网上搜索下载这些软件后安装,按照 提示操作就可以了。以下是比较常见的一种方法:1.下载upd-1.zip压缩文件(到网上...

linux权限,如图 建立\/test\/1.txt ,在root下设置了权限,但是切换到stu...
首先,在截图里,user的权限是rwx,user是student,所以student用户肯定有修改权限。那么一楼和三楼的说法一般情况下不成立。二楼的说法可取,涉及到隐藏属性。打 chattr -i \/test\/1.txt 这个命令,或者试试chattr -a \/test\/1.txt,然后再试着删除。第二种情况,有可能文件正在被实用,可以用kill...

linux系统普通用户 su - 切换到root权限 提示登录提示10s超时,假设这...
- 重启系统进入grub菜单kernel行尾添加 rw init=\/bin\/bash车按b启进入shell,切换\/etc目录编辑passwd文件保存并重启

基本linux命令
基本linux命令有哪些呢?1、ls命令就是list 的缩写,通过 ls 命令不仅可以查看 linux 文件夹包含的文件,而且可以查看文件权限(包括目录、文件夹、文件权限) 查看目录信息等等。常用参数搭配:ls -a 列出目录所有文件,包含以.开始的隐藏文件ls -A 列出除.及..的其它文件ls -r 反序排列ls -t 以文件修改时间排序ls...

linux命令的~$如何切换到#
非root(管理员)用户的符号会显示$,而root(管理员)用户则会显示#(代表权力至高无上)———以debian的发行版为例:xxx@xxx~$ (输入->) su rootpassword:(此时输入你的root密码,且密码不会显示,放心输入回车即可)root@root\/home\/xxx#(此时便是完成转换了,若继续输入 su ~ 可返回原...

LINUX常用命令的使用和技巧:[1]基础篇
2. ls 查看目录或者文件的属*,列举出任一目录下面的文件 eg: ls \/usr\/man ls -l a.d表示目录(directory),如果是一个"-"表示是文件,如果是l则表示是一个连接文件(link) b.表示文件或者目录许可权限.分别用可读(r),可写(w),可运行(x)。 3. cp 拷贝文件 eg: cp filename...

Linux下root用户切换到其他目录后无法执行任何命令 可输入命令但回车没...
1,在\/etc\/passwd中将用户abc的登录shell改成:abc:x:501:501::\/home\/abc:\/bin\/bash -r 2,将此用户的.bash_profile文件中PATH指定一个工作目录:exportPATH=${PATH}:~\/mybin 3,将用户abc只能执行的几个常用命令,如ls等,cp到此目录,cp \/bin\/ls \/home\/abc\/mybin #ln也可 4,完成 设定好...

linux系统切换不了用户了怎么办啊??
1.直接输入su 2.直接用root登陆 3.修改配置文件 4.不要作死,乱改一气 5.希望可以帮助你,请采纳

在linux中cd命令怎么切换目录,要详细的!
有两种方法,一种是使用相对路径,如你在\/home\/user目录,你想进入\/home目录,则打入 cd ..另一种是用绝对路径,与逆目前的目录没关系。你可以打 cd \/home 进入。注意,你要进入的目录必须是逆的权限能进入的地方,例如你作为普通用户,是无法进入管理员的主目录\/root的。

孝南区18839577024: linux系统怎么用命令切换用户 -
殷顺雷帕: linux系统下su命令来切换用户,su是switch user切换用户的缩写.可以实现root用户到普通用户之间的转换.从普通用户切换到root用户需要输入密码,从root用户切换到普通用户不需要输入密码. 1、命令格式:su [参数] [-] [用户名] 2、用法示例...

孝南区18839577024: linux系统中从普通用户权限切换到管理员权限命令?快捷键? -
殷顺雷帕: 在终端中输入su

孝南区18839577024: linux中怎么从普通用户切换到root -
殷顺雷帕: su是在用户间切换,可以是从普通用户切换到root用户,也可以是从root用户切换到普通用户.如果当前是root用户,那么切换成普通用户test用以下命令:su - test 如果要切换回root用户,那么用以下命令:su或su - 用户名root可以省略不写.切换回root用户时要输入root密码.一般直接输入exit命令来切换回root用户,这样就不用输入密码.

孝南区18839577024: linux下切换用户命令 -
殷顺雷帕: su 普通用户名 从root 切换到普通用户不需要密码 如果要登录时候家在该用户的shell 就用 su - 普通用户名.有本书《Linux就该这么学》,简单到复杂的命令应有尽有,没事多看看就学会了.

孝南区18839577024: linux如何使用chown改变权限? -
殷顺雷帕: 1:改变拥有者和群组,命令:chown mail:mail server.log.2:改变文件拥有者和群组,命令:chown root: server.log.3:改变文件群组,命令:chown :mail server.log,4:改变指定目录以及其子目录下的所有文件的拥有者和群组.命令:chown -R -v root:mail test6.-R 处理指定目录以及其子目录下的所有文件.-v 显示详细的处理信息,尽请关注《linux就该这么学》官网.

孝南区18839577024: LINUX怎么切换用户?
殷顺雷帕: 图形界面下点注销重新登录就行 文本模式或者终端里面的命令是 su 用户名 如果不加用户名就是切换到root 切换用户以后返回当前用户命令 exit 如果不切换用户而是临时获取root权限的话用 sudo 命令

孝南区18839577024: linux如何修改特定用户对某个文件的权限? -
殷顺雷帕: linux中,可以使用chown命令来修改文件夹的用户权限.步骤如下;1. 以普通用户admin登录linux,利用su -切换到root用户,将自动挂载在/media/下的Qt文件夹拷贝到/home/admin/Projects下. 2. 切换到文件夹所在的目录,使用chown命令,即可修改权限. 命令:# chown admin ./LCDCS 3. 使用命令 chown --help,来查询帮助文档. 4. 如果文件夹内还包含文件夹,那可以对chown命令添加 -R参数 命令:# chown -R admin ./LCDCS

孝南区18839577024: 如何chmod命令更改Linux文件夹权限 -
殷顺雷帕: 文件/目录权限设置命令:chmod 这是Linux系统管理员最常用到的命令之一,它用于改变文件或目录的访问权限.该命令有两种用法: 1.用包含字母和操作符表达式的文字设定法 其语法格式为:chmod [who] [opt] [mode] 文件/目录名 2.用数字设定法 :chmod [mode] 文件名

孝南区18839577024: linux怎样切换到root 用户 -
殷顺雷帕: 对,在命令行输入:su - 就能切换到root用户.前提你有root密码

孝南区18839577024: linux 下怎样启用root用户 -
殷顺雷帕:方法:1:Redhat系统或者Fedora或者CentOs的Linux发行版,那么在Linux终端输入命令回车:su - root这样就可以切换到root权限了2:Ubuntu系统,在Linux终端输入命令回车:sudo su - root然后这样也可以切换到root权限了.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网